AppNexus Hires Ex-CEO of 24/7 Media As CFO

Public experience hints at Wall Street ambitions

AppNexus has hired former 24/7 Media CEO Jon Hsu as chief financial officer, adding another veteran of the ad tech world and signaling its ambitions to eventually take the company public.

CEO Brian O’Kelley told Adweek that Hsu’s hire solidifies the leadership at AppNexus, a team that already includes people like Michael Rubenstein, who once helped run Google’s DoubleClick Ad Exchange.

Hsu, who most recently led eco-tech startup Recyclebank, helmed 24/7 when it was a publicly traded company and sold to WPP–for $650 million in 2007.
